Highlights:District 3-AAA first round
At Elizabethtown, the Bulldogs (17-5-2) won on an own goal in overtime to defeat the Bears (11-7-1) and advance to a quarterfinal against second-seeded Red Land Saturday at 5:30 p.m. at Hempfield.
The score came during a scramble in front of the Elizabethtown net after a Wilson throw-in. A Bears defender mishit a ball he was trying to clear, lobbing it over keeper Quinn Cozzens' head and into the back of the net with 2:30 left in the first overtime period.
The goal came shortly after the Bears hit the crossbar.
"Elizabethtown is a real quality team," said Wilson coach Tim Fick. "We dodged a bullet tonight."
In regulation, both teams played sloppily on a saturated field and only generated a few quality scoring opportunities.
Bulldogs keeper Scott Krotee made a couple big saves to keep the game scoreless through regulation.
